Abstract

In this article the author analyses the reasons why the Spanish state established the Tribunal de la Inquisición in the Viceroyalty of Peru in 1569. lt claims that this institution was part of a colonial political design thought up by Felipe II at the end of 1560, and that its purpose was to deal with the political and ideological crisis generated by the colonial scheme itself.
